Free Webinar Series Offered for Dairy Farmers

Share article

BURLINGTON – A new webinar series will delve into topics of interest to dairy farmers in northern New England, including current dairy research and programs, funding opportunities, shared industry challenges and practices to improve dairy management and increase profitability.

The Tri-State Dairy Exchange: Navigating the Future of Dairy series  will be held on the last Wednesday of each month from 11:30 a.m. to 12:30 p.m. It is sponsored by the Tri-State Dairy Team and features presentations and roundtable discussions with Extension dairy professionals from the University of Vermont (UVM), University of New Hampshire and University of Maine and other guest presenters.

Although there is no charge to participate, a one-time registration is required to receive an email with the webinar link, which will work for all sessions. To register, go to http://go.uvm.edu/conferences.

Information about the webinars can be found at  https://go.uvm.edu/tristatedairy.

Dates and topics for winter and spring include January 29, Grant Applications: Tips, Tricks and Resources; February 26, Ben and Jerry’s Low Carbon Dairy Program; March 28: Spotlight on the Dairy Farm of the Year awardees in Maine, New Hampshire and Vermont; April 30, Virtual Fencing Update: Farmer Panel; and May 28, Crossover Event with the Maine Farmcast: Hay Crop Silage Production and Management.

All sessions will be recorded and posted to the UVM Extension Northwest Crops and Soils Program YouTube channel at  www.youtube.com/user/cropsoilsvteam.

To request a disability-related accommodation to participate, please contact Susan Brouillette at (802) 656-7611 or  [email protected]  at least three weeks prior to the date of the webinar.
